Dream About Bridges: Understanding Their Significance
When bridges make an appearance in our dreams, they often carry profound meanings. These dream scenarios can serve as reflections of our personal experiences and emotions, as well as our relationships with others. The symbolism surrounding bridges typically resonates with transitions, connections, and vital changes in life.
General Interpretation of Dreaming About Bridges
Dreaming of bridges generally signifies a passage or transition from one phase of life to another. This can be an indicator of personal growth, changes in relationships, or new opportunities that lie ahead. A bridge could represent both the support system we have to navigate life's challenges as well as the feeling of stability that we need in an ever-changing world. Whether the bridge appears sturdy or dilapidated in your dream can reflect your current emotional state regarding these transitions.
Symbolism of Bridges in Dreams
- Connections with Others: Bridges symbolize the emotional ties we have with others. This can signify how well we relate to people in different areas of our lives—be it family, friends, or colleagues.
- Navigating Life's Rivers: Psychologically, a bridge allows one to cross life's obstacles, standing as a metaphor for overcoming challenges and transitioning into new experiences.
Interpretations Based on Specific Scenarios
Men Dreaming of Crossings
For men, crossing a bridge in a dream is often seen as a positive omen, suggesting health, longevity, and success in their endeavors. It indicates a need to focus on their wellbeing and life's journey.
Dreaming of Different Bridge Scenarios
- Seeing a Broken Bridge: A dream featuring a broken bridge suggests looming obstacles or difficulties that might need to be addressed before one can move forward.
- Crossing a Wooden Bridge: This scenario generally brings good luck. It indicates that while the path may be uncertain, proceeding with caution will lead to positive outcomes.
- Building Bridges: If you dream about constructing a bridge, it denotes that you are actively creating connections and pathways in your life. It may also symbolize the establishment of new relationships or opportunities.
Psychological Perspective on Bridge Dreams
From a psychological standpoint, bridges may represent the boundary between the known and the unknown future. They often denote the ability to communicate and forge connections with others.
- Success in Communication: If you dream of calling out to someone on a bridge, it could mean there will be fruitful communications ahead and perhaps a resolution to a sticky situation.
- Repairing Bridges: Seeing yourself fixing a bridge in your dreams often symbolizes restoring relationships or mending unresolved issues.
Case Study: Analyzing a Bridge Dream
For instance, let's consider a case where an individual, named Xiao Zheng, recently received a promotion at work and felt anxious about his new responsibilities. One night, he dreamt of crossing a rickety iron bridge that lacked some path segments. Despite the fear, he managed to cross it. Upon waking, he felt motivated and confident. On that same day, his work performance impressed his superiors, leading to further accolades.
In this scenario, the rickety bridge symbolizes a significant challenge or fear in his career—yet the act of crossing it highlights his resilience and preparedness to face obstacles. In essence, his dream reflects that Xiao Zheng is on a journey towards greater achievements and personal growth.
Conclusion
In summary, dreaming of bridges often encapsulates the complex experiences of life transitions, emotional connections, and significant changes that we all navigate. Understanding these dreams can aid in self-reflection and provide guidance on how to approach the paths ahead. Whether they signify good fortune or caution, recognizing the symbolism attached to bridges can empower us to face our personal journeys with greater awareness and resourcefulness.
